Output 866e18f81a0748b81160734aed9c9752b64428fad61a03d29d63f63fe918bfa4:0
- value
- 12974233
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a9556bdb71a8b802944db5ae061fdc5ab43c99de OP_EQUAL
- address
- 3H8NT966vUx1Mp9YHyo6wR9FVryKxtPKg5
- transaction
- 866e18f81a0748b81160734aed9c9752b64428fad61a03d29d63f63fe918bfa4
- spent
- true